Specifying the transmit / radiated power
Depending on whether you want to use a third-party antenna and/or antenna cable with a
reader, you need to select the suitable components. When selecting third-party components
orient yourself on the values of comparable Siemens products.
With the readers, the parameters for the transmit/radiated power, antenna gain and cable
loss (user-defined) are set using the WBM. In the WBM, you can select the Siemens
products being used from a drop-down list quickly and easily, and the values and their effect
on the transmit/radiated power are calculated directly. With third-party products, you can
enter the relevant values manually.
Based on the entered products/values, the WBM calculates the permitted radiated power
and makes sure that this is not exceeded.

Types of antenna

In principle, all types of directional antennas can be considered as antennas for integration
into the SIMATIC RF600 system. Directional antennas have a preferred direction in which
more energy is radiated than in other directions.
RF600 antennas on the other hand, are optimized for operation with RF600 readers and
have all the required approvals.

Antenna cables

Selection criteria
You must observe the criteria listed below when selecting the appropriate antenna cable.
Characteristic impedance
Note the following points when selecting the antenna cable:
● You can only use coaxial antenna cables when connecting an antenna.
● These antenna cables must have a nominal characteristic impedance of Z = 50 Ohm.
